Output 6ae19927482ea9b4c7cb0a54e9bd8f4241d31b26ccbceeed0f8a7174981dc313:1

value
1498432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a106fa1f2c3f20de2a3f970f5da39729ab6ac3b OP_EQUAL
address
3EH2s1mtYGhLfGyXDS4KyTRVJ1YjfDHC4L
transaction
6ae19927482ea9b4c7cb0a54e9bd8f4241d31b26ccbceeed0f8a7174981dc313
confirmations
221486
spent
true